Nearby Discovery Ski is a ski resort featuring a tremendous 1,670-foot drop. Discovery Ski has 48 ski slopes and 6 good ski lifts and obtains 17 feet of snow annually. The 480 acres of skiable territory at Discovery Ski is esteemed by skiers from all over. Discovery Ski has 55% difficult ski slopes and 45% blue and green ski slopes.
